The Dodecanese campaign of World War II was an attempt by Allied forces to capture the Italian Dodecanese islands in the Aegean Sea following the Armistice with Italy in September 1943, and use them as bases against the German-controlled Balkans. Wikipedia
Dates: Sep 8, 1943 – Nov 22, 1943
Location: Dodecanese Islands, Aegean Sea, and Italian Islands of the Aegean
